A municipality operates under a predicate of disposal — their materials are waste-classified, their contracts are with haulers, they pay to make the materials disappear.
Carbotura shifts that to a predicate of manufacturing — the same materials become feedstock inputs for a manufacturing process. The economic relationship inverts.
The materials don't change. The classification, the contract, and the economic direction all do.

Cities generate over 100 million tons of manufacturing feedstock each year. Landfills are consolidating. Disposal costs are rising. The same conditions that built the legacy system are creating demand for what replaces it.
With 200–300 U.S. landfills closing in the next five years, municipalities are signing 20- and 30-year agreements to secure processing capacity. Predictable intake means predictable revenue.
Hauling manufacturing feedstock across state lines is the most volatile line item in a city's disposal budget. Long-term offtake agreements stabilize costs for decades.
Carbotura recovers synthetic graphite, graphene compounds, recovered metals, rare earth elements, and ultrapure water from the same material that used to be landfilled. Paid on intake. Recovery is upside.

Legacy hauling companies don't disappear in the Carbotura model — they transition. Instead of transporting material to landfills for destruction, Feedstock Haulers deliver manufacturing feedstock to the modular factory for conversion into high-value materials.
The logistics function remains. The destination, purpose, and economic model change entirely. Feedstock Haulers become part of the ACM supply chain — transporting the most abundant, perpetually renewable manufacturing feedstock on earth.
